Tactile and proprioceptive temporal discrimination are impaired in functional tremor.

Abstract

BACKGROUND AND METHODS

In order to obtain further information on the pathophysiology of functional tremor, we assessed tactile discrimination threshold and proprioceptive temporal discrimination motor threshold values in 11 patients with functional tremor, 11 age- and sex-matched patients with essential tremor and 13 healthy controls.

RESULTS

Tactile discrimination threshold in both the right and left side was significantly higher in patients with functional tremor than in the other groups. Proprioceptive temporal discrimination threshold for both right and left side was significantly higher in patients with functional and essential tremor than in healthy controls. No significant correlation between discrimination thresholds and duration or severity of tremor was found.

CONCLUSIONS

Temporal processing of tactile and proprioceptive stimuli is impaired in patients with functional tremor. The mechanisms underlying this impaired somatosensory processing and possible ways to apply these findings clinically merit further research.

摘要

背景与方法

为了获取关于功能性震颤病理生理学的更多信息,我们评估了11例功能性震颤患者、11例年龄和性别匹配的特发性震颤患者以及13名健康对照者的触觉辨别阈值和本体感觉时间辨别运动阈值。

结果

功能性震颤患者双侧的触觉辨别阈值显著高于其他组。功能性震颤和特发性震颤患者双侧的本体感觉时间辨别阈值显著高于健康对照者。未发现辨别阈值与震颤持续时间或严重程度之间存在显著相关性。

结论

功能性震颤患者对触觉和本体感觉刺激的时间处理受损。这种体感处理受损的潜在机制以及将这些发现应用于临床的可能方法值得进一步研究。
